Ppb detection of Sarin surrogate in liquid solutions

Résumé

Sarin, a well-known chemical warfare agent, is toxic for concentrations as low as 0.03 ppm in the air (Immediately Dangerous to Life or Health value). A technology providing "on the field" detection could be fluorescence spectroscopy. This presentation shows a sensitive method for the detection of Diethyl Chlorophosphate (DCP), a Sarin surrogate, which provides in a few seconds a turn-off fluorescence response of the sensor for ppb levels of DCP. For instance, a I/I0 = 0.68 (fluorescence quenching) was obtained when the sensor was exposed to 16 ppb of DCP.
